目的:通过对存在骨质疏松等骨病患者血清骨标志物的测定,结合X线影像分析,探讨骨标志物在骨质疏松性疾病诊断中的表达及意义。方法收集2011年10月至2012年9月期间到我院就诊的骨病患者400例,骨质疏松组200例,骨折事件组200例,分别于早上7:00~9:00进行静脉采血和X线摄影,血液样本同时测定骨转换标志物组合血清β-胶原降解产物(β-crosslaps)、N 端骨钙素(N-MID)、甲状旁腺素(PTH),收集骨标志物结果和X线影像结果,对照X线影像结果进行分析。结果结合X线摄影结果判断,2组 X线影片结果均显示存在不同程度的骨质退行性改变或骨质疏松症,骨折患者合并有骨质疏松性骨折表现。400例患者骨标志物组合显示,单独检测β-crosslaps阳性率占72.7%,N-MID阳性率占13.0%,PTH阳性率占7.5%。联合检测阳性率占75.5%。结论作为骨标志物,β-胶原交联C末端肽(β-CTX)可作为骨质疏松症的独立风险预测指标,联合测定或结合X线影像结果分析有利于提高骨质疏松症的风险评估。

Objective To investigate the sensitivity expression of bone markers in the diagnosis of osteoporosis and osteoporotic fractures by measuring bone markers between the osteoporosis and bone disease patients and combined with the X-ray analysis. Methods Four hundred patients from October 2011 to September 2012 in our hospital were collected, 200 cases were in the osteoporosis group while 200 cases were in the bone fractures group. At 7-9 o′clock in the morning, all cases underwent both venous blood collection and X-ray photography. At the same time, all blood samples also had been measured bone turnover markers including serum β-collagen degradation products(β-crosslaps), N-terminal osteocalcin (N-MID) and parathyroid hormone (PTH). Analyse the sensitivity and specificity of the bone turnover maker results with X-ray images results. Results With X-ray photography judgement, two X-ray image results showed that all patients had different degrees of bone degenerative changes , especially the patients in fracture group had osteoporotic fractures. The bone turnover markers results of 400 patients showed the positive rate was respectively 72.7%, 13.0% and 7.5% by β-CTX、N-MID and PTH, and the positive rate was 75.5% by combined detection of both bone turnover maker and X-ray. Conclusion β-crosslaps could be used as a more independent predictor of osteoporosis , and combined with X-ray results, it could improve the osteoporosis diagnosis.
